Combine: 4 cups good flour
1 envelope instant yeast
1 tablespoons soft butter
2 tablespoon olive oil
1 1/2 teaspoon sugar
1 1/2 teaspoon salt

Then add 1 egg to a 1 cup, fill rest w/warm water, then slowly add liquid 
dough should pull away from the sides of the bowl--its an art
Stand mixer ingredients for 8 minutes-ish w/hook or until you can make a doughwindow
Allow dough to rest 45 minutes in a warm place and double in size
Form 6-12 equal pieces into discs, set close together in olive oil coated pan
Rub with olive oil and coat with shredded cheeses or salts of your choice
Rise 1 hour or until tripled in size, leaves a finger mark
Bake 350 for 15-20 minutes, or till golden

Store in a sealed container
